American Staffordshire Terrier vs Bolognese
People compare the American Staffordshire Terrier and the Bolognese because both are loyal, affectionate dogs who bond deeply with their people. But that’s where the similarities end. It’s like choosing between a pickup truck and a vintage scooter. you’ll get from point A to B, but the ride feels completely different. The AmStaff is a sturdy, medium-sized dog built with muscle and confidence. You’ll need space. preferably a yard. and a routine that includes daily exercise and mental challenges. They’re great with older kids, but their strength and energy mean they’re not ideal for timid owners or first-timers. They thrive on structure and can handle suburban life, but you’ll want to check local breed restrictions. They’re not high shedders, but their short coat won’t help if someone in the house has allergies. The Bolognese, on the other hand, is a tiny, fluffy companion dog bred for laps and luxury. They adapt beautifully to apartment living and are perfect for someone home most of the day. like retirees or remote workers. They’re low-shedding and often tolerated by allergy sufferers, but their coat needs regular brushing to avoid mats. They’re not outdoor dogs. You won’t go hiking with a Bolognese, but you will have a shadow who’s always nearby, quietly devoted. Here’s the real talk: the AmStaff will love the whole family, but the Bolognese will pick one person and stick to them like velcro. If you want a dog who’ll join your active life and handle the chaos of kids and weekends outdoors, go AmStaff. If you want a gentle, portable pal who thrives on calm and closeness, the Bolognese is your match. Just know. neither does well when left alone for hours. Love is their fuel.
